Регистр сдвига Советский патент 1983 года по МПК G11C19/30 

Описание патента на изобретение SU1015442A1

Изобретение относится к вычисительной технике и может быть исользовано в цифровых вычислительных устройствах вустройствах визуальной индикации, в индикаторах движущегося текста или динамических табло. 5

Известен регистр сдвига, содержащий оптроны на фоторезисторах и излучателях с положительной обратной связью, а также дополнительные излучатели и две тактовых им- 10

ПУЛЬСОВ Tl 1... ,

недостатком устройства является Невозможность использования такого регистра для динамических табло, так как.в нем два соседних оптрона 5 питаются от разных шин тактовых им- пульсов и не могут одновременно быть в состоянии излучения, что необхо- . димо для динамических табло. Кроме того, количество ячеек изображения -« Или оптррнов может быть в таком регистре только четным. Недостатком является также наличие двух шин тактового импульса.

Известен также регистр сдвига, « -содержащий две группы электроннооптических элементов памяти, в которых выходы соответствующих друг ругу разрядов объединены 2. ,

Недостатком известного устройст- : ва является то, что в каждый момент 30 времени в них содержится одинаковая информация, что является аппаратурно излишне.

Наиболее близок к предлагаемо- ay по технической сущности регистр 35 сдвига, содержащий две группы электронно-оптических элементов памяти, оторые в каждой группе соединены электрически последовательно, шину установки в начальное состояние, 40 подключенную к нулевым входам, и единичным входам первой и второй группы соответственно, а нулевой вход и единичный выход каждого элемента памяти первой группы оптически связаны с оптически единичным выходом и нулевым входом каждого элемента памяти второй группы соответстйенно з.,

Недостатком указанного регистра сдвига является невозможность ис- . пользования, его для динамических табло для сдвига меняющейся информа-. ции на входе регистра, так как он может работать толь.ко как реверсивный счетчик и регистр с представлением информации в единичном прямом 55 и инверсном кодах. С помощью известного регистра невозможно получить чередование единичных и нулевых состояний в соседних элементах памяти ни в первой, ни во второй группах 60 элементов памяти..

Цель изобретения - расширение области применения регистра сдвига |3а счет возможности осуществления еверсивного сдвига информации. гс

Поставленная цель достигается тем, что в регистр сдвига, содержащий две группы электронно-оптических элементов памяти, первые входы которых соединены с шиной сброса, второй вход и первый выход каждого электронно-оптического элемента памяти первой группы оптически связаны с первым выходом и вторым входом каждого электронно-оптического элемента памяти, второй, группы соответственно, шину управления и шину питания, введеныуправляемый источник света и ключи, первые входы которых соединены с шиной управления, вторые входы ключей соединены соответственно с шинами питания, управляющий вход управляемого источника света является информационным входом регистра сдвига,первый выход. первого ключа соединён с первыг1 выходом второго ключа и третьими входами электронно-оптических элементов памяти, второй выход первого клча соединен со вторым выходом второго ключа и четвертьаН входами элеронно-оптических элементов памяти, выход управляемого источника света соединен оптически с пятыми входами Первых и последних электронно-оптических элементов памяти первой и второй групп, первый выход каждого электронно-оптического элемента памяти первой группы соединен с шестыми входами предыдущих электроннооптических элементов памяти первой и второй групп. I .

На чертеже изображена функциональная схема предлагаемого регистра сдвига.

Регистр содержит управляемый источник 1 света, ключи 2 и 3, электронно-оптические элементы 4 памяти первой группы, электронно-оптические элементы 5 памяти второй группка, шину б управлений, шины 7 и 8 питания, шину 9 сброса. Управляемый источник 1 света содержит элемент НЕ 10, резисторы 11 и 12, светодиоды 13 и 14.

Устройство работает следующим образом.

В начальный момент времени благодаря воздействию импульса установки на шину 9 регистр сдвига устанавливается в исходное состояние, т.е. все электронно-оптические эутементы 4 памяти первой -группы устанавливаются в нулевое состояние, а все элементы 5 памяти второй группы устанавливаются в единичное состояние. . При подаче управляемого сигнала на шину б управления.включаются ключи 2 и 3 . На шины-7 и 8 питания ,поданы. соответственно напряжения положительной и отрицательной полярностей. На первых выходах ключей 2 и 3

появляется положительное напряжение Пусть в исходный момент на входе .регистра присутствует сигнал логической единицы. Другими словами,, информация, на входе, меняется во времени по тактам следующим образом 1111 ... В этом случае регистр сдвига будет .работать в режиме сдвига вправо входной информации. При появлении первой логической единицы на входе регистра начинает излучатьсветодиод 13 и гаснет светодиод 14. Благодаря этому впервый такт сдвига первый элемент 4 памяти первой группы переходит в единичное состояние, первый элемент 5 памяти второй группы - в нулевое состояние, так как сигнал с выхода источника 1 света воздейству;ет на пятые входы первых элементов 4 и 5 первой и второй групп. При .31ТОМ на выходе регистра сдвига, оптиг ческий входной сигнал отсутствует. Код в первой группе элементов 4 будет 1 О О О... Во второй группе элементов 5 будет инверсный код О 1 1 1 ... В последующих тактах сдвига последовательно переходят в единичное состояние элементы 4 первой группы и обнуляются соответствующие элементы 5 второй группы. Если необходимо прекратить сдвиг входной информации, то с шины 6 управления поступает управляющий сигнал и ключи 2 и 3 оказываются в исходном состоянии.

При г одаче управляющего сигнала влево на шину б управления ключи 2 и 3 вновь включаются и на вторых входах появляется напряжение положительной полярности. .

Предположим, что в регистре сдвига записана следующая инфогмийция: в первой группе элементов -4 11100....; во второй группе элементов 5 - 00011....

Входной сигнал на взводе регистра в данном режиме отсутствует. В этом случае регистр будет работать в режиме сдвигЭ| влево входной информации. 3 первом такте сдвига в единичное состояние переходит третий элемент 5 второй группы и обнуляется третий элемент 4 первой.группы.

После первого такта сдвига записанная информация в регистре сдвига будет: в первой группе элементов 4 - 11000.... во ВТОРОЙ группе элементов 5 - 00111... .

В последующих двух тактах переходят в единичное состояние второй и первый элементы 5 второй группы и в нулевое .состояние элементы 4 первой группы. Если необходимо остановить процесс сдвига, с щины б подается управляющий сигнал и ключи 2 и 3 оказываются в исходном состоянии. Если необходимо производить сдвиг влево информации на п элеменг

тов 4 и 5, начиная со старшего разряда, на вход регистра необходимо подавать сигнал, равный п тактам сдвига.

Пусть необходимо произвести сдвиг 5 любой входной информации вправо. Например, на вход регистра подается логическая единица длительностью, .равной двум тактам сдвига,,и через время, равное .одному такту сдвига.

Друсгими словами, информация на входе регистра меняется во времени по тактам следующим образом ilOlll. При этом .при подаче управляющего сигнала с шины 6 на первых выходах

5 ключей 2 и 3 присутствует положительное напряжение.

При появлении первой логической единицы на входе регистра 8 начинает излучать светодиод 13 и гаснет, светодиод 14.Благодаря этому в

0 первый такт сдвига первый 4 переходит в единичное состояние, а первый элемент 5 памяти - в нулевое состояние.. Код в первой группе элементов 4 будет 1000, код во второй

группе элементов 5 будет 0111. Во |Втором такте сдвига на .входе регистра снова появляется сигнал, соответствующий уровню логической единицы, и элемент 4 останется в единич0ном состоянии, а элемент 5 - в нулевом. В результате того-, что сигнал |С оптического выхода первого эленен.та 4 воздействовал на шестой вход . второго элемента 5 и на пятый вход

5 второго элемента 4, последний во втором такте перейдет в единичное , состояние, а второй элемент 5 - в нулевое состояние. Код в цервой группе элементов 4 после двух тактов

0 будет выглядеть 11000, а во второй группе элементов- 5 - 00111.

В третьем такте сдвига на входе регистра появляется логический нуль и светодиод 13 перестает излучать,

f а начинает излучать светодитэд 14, так как последний, подключен к.выходу элемента НЕ 10, на выходе которого появится логическая единица. Вследствие этЬ.го оптический сигнал с выхода источника света 1 устано0вит первый элемент 4 в нулевое состояние, а первый элемент 5 - в единичное состояние.

Сигнал с оптического выхода пер55 foro элемента 4 не изменит состояние вторых элементов 4 и 5 первой и второй групп. Сигнал с оптическо,го выхода второго элемента 4 в третьем такте установит в единичное . состояние третий элемент 5. и в нуле вое состояние третий элемент 4; Коды соответственно будут такими: в первой группе - 011000, во второй 10111. В четвертом такте логическая единица на входе регистра переве65 ;цет. первый элемент 4 в единичное состояние, а первый элемент 5 - в нулевое. Информация в первой групп.е элементов 4 и во второй группе сдви нется на один элемент.. Коды соответственно будут такими: в первой rpynrie элементов 4, 101100, во вто рой группе элементов 5 - 010011. Аналогично процесс продолжается дал ше. Предположим, что необходимо сдвинуть влево записанную в регистре информацию. Пусть в регистре записана следую щая информация: в первой группе эле ментов 4 - 1Ш0111, во второй группе элементов 5 - 001000. При этом с подачей управляющего сигнала с шины б на вторых входах ключей 2 и 3 появляется положительное напряжение. Коды в элементах 4 и 5 будут соответственно следующими:. в первой группе -1011100, во второй группе 0100011. Аналогично процесс продолжается и дальше. Из работы устройства видно, что первая группа элементов 4 воспроизводит оптически информацию в прямом коде, а вторая группа элементов 5 в инверсном коде. Предлагаемый регистр сдвига может .сдвигать вправо и влево любые после-довательности входной информации, что расширяет его область применения. Как и известный регистр он может использоваться для преобразования времени в единичный код. Если в течение измеряемого времени на вход регистра воздействует:сигнал, соответствующий уровню логической единицы, то в единичное состояние установится элементов 4 первой группы, сколько тактов сдвига уложится в измененном измеряемом промежутке времени, «.е. в регистре будет единичный код, соответствующий измеряемому промежутку времени в первой группе и инверсньгй код в элементах 5 во второй группу. Регистр сдвига может применяться в устройствах отображения информации для динамических табло, причем в регистре воспроизводится как позитивное, так и негативное изображение, так как в его первой группе элементов воспроизводится прямой код, а во второй - инверсный, а также может применяться в качестве реверсивного счетчика, последовательного сумматора и преобразователя временного интервала в код.

Похожие патенты SU1015442A1

название год авторы номер документа
Электронно-оптический регистр сдвига 1981
  • Кожемяко Владимир Прокофьевич
  • Красиленко Владимир Григорьевич
  • Тимченко Леонид Иванович
SU972596A1
Устройство для считывания изображений 1986
  • Кожемяко Владимир Прокофьевич
  • Теренчук Анатолий Тимофеевич
  • Тимченко Леонид Иванович
  • Кожемяко Константин Владимирович
SU1429142A1
Устройство для параллельного суммирования длительностей импульсов 1985
  • Кожемяко Владимир Прокофьевич
  • Красиленко Владимир Григорьевич
  • Колесницкий Олег Константинович
SU1354213A1
Устройство для индикации 1989
  • Калитурин Владимир Николаевич
SU1667150A1
Устройство для контроля блоков постоянной памяти 1983
  • Самойлов Алексей Лаврентьевич
SU1104590A1
Устройство для вычисления элементарных функций 1984
  • Баранов Владимир Леонидович
SU1168930A1
Устройство для считывания графической информации 1988
  • Калитурин Владимир Николаевич
SU1536413A1
Устройство для контроля логических блоков 1984
  • Белоусов Владимир Васильевич
  • Зимин Владимир Александрович
  • Казаринова Софья Марковна
  • Кузнецов Игорь Иванович
SU1196692A1
Логическое запоминающее устройство 1977
  • Балашов Евгений Павлович
  • Варлинский Николай Николаевич
  • Волкогонов Владимир Никитич
  • Негода Виктор Николаевич
  • Степанов Виктор Степанович
SU733024A1
Логическое запоминающее устройство 1978
  • Балашов Евгений Павлович
  • Варлинский Николай Николаевич
  • Волкогонов Владимир Никитич
  • Степанов Виктор Степанович
SU771720A1

Иллюстрации к изобретению SU 1 015 442 A1

Реферат патента 1983 года Регистр сдвига

РЕГИСТР СДШИГА, содержащий две группы электронно-оптических элементов памяти, первые входы которых соединены с шиной сброса, второй вход и первый выход кгикдого электронно-оптического элемента памяти первой группы.оптически связаны с первъш выходом и BTOPEIM входом каждого электронно-оптического элемента памяти второй группы соответственно, шину управления и шины питания, отличающийся тем, что, с целью расширения области применения регистра сдвига за счет возможности осуществления реверсявного сдвига информации,, в него введены управляемый источник света и ключи, первые входал которых соединены с шиной управления, вторые входы ключей соединены .соответственно с шинами питания, управлякяций вход управляемого источника света является информационные входом регистра сдвига, первый выход первого ключа соединен с первым выходом второго ключа и .третьими входами электронно-оптических элементов памяти второй выход первого ключа соединен с вторым выходомвторого § ключа и четвертыми входами элект- ронно-ЬптическиХ элементов памяти, (П выход управляемого источника соединен оптически с пятыми входами первых и последних электронно-оптических элементов памяти первой и g второй групп, первый выход каждого электронно-оптического элемента памяти первой группы соединен с шестыми входами.предьадущих электронно-оптических элементов первой и второй групп. tn

Документы, цитированные в отчете о поиске Патент 1983 года SU1015442A1

Печь для непрерывного получения сернистого натрия 1921
  • Настюков А.М.
  • Настюков К.И.
SU1A1
Походная разборная печь для варки пищи и печения хлеба 1920
  • Богач Б.И.
SU11A1
Аппарат для очищения воды при помощи химических реактивов 1917
  • Гордон И.Д.
SU2A1
Походная разборная печь для варки пищи и печения хлеба 1920
  • Богач Б.И.
SU11A1
Устройство станционной централизации и блокировочной сигнализации 1915
  • Романовский Я.К.
SU1971A1
Переносная печь для варки пищи и отопления в окопах, походных помещениях и т.п. 1921
  • Богач Б.И.
SU3A1

SU 1 015 442 A1

Авторы

Кожемяко Владимир Прокофьевич

Тимченко Леонид Иванович

Красиленко Владимир Григорьевич

Даты

1983-04-30Публикация

1981-05-20Подача